Why is there no game sound on my Xbox One headset?

Check your headset settings

If you're experiencing audio issues where you can't hear or others can't hear you, first check the headset's volume, balance, and mute settings: The headset volume is controlled by turning the dial on the outside of the right earcup. Be sure the headset volume isn't turned all the way down.

What does mono output mean Xbox?

Mono output combines all audio channels into one, so that the same sound can be heard in all speakers (rather than stereo).

How do I update my Xbox headset?

You can check if your headset's firmware is up to date by clicking the (…) button on the headset settings screen. If a new update is available, select Update now to update your headset. This can take a few minutes – leave your headset turned on, motionless, and close to your console until the update is complete.

Can you connect AirPods to Xbox One?

Unfortunately, Microsoft's Xbox One lacks Bluetooth support, meaning it has no built-in way to pair Apple AirPods to the console. It's also impossible to connect AirPods to the Xbox One controller headphone jack.

Why is only audio playing for video?

This problem is often caused by a codec issue. A movie may be created to utilize a certain codec to allow the file to be smaller and more portable. However, for the movie file to be played in the media player it must also have the codec installed.

Should Xbox be HDMI in or out?

Connect the HDMI cable to the HDMI OUT port on your console (the leftmost HDMI port on the back of your console). Do not connect the HDMI cable to the HDMI IN port on your console.

Should I turn on passthrough?

Passthrough isn't a necessity, and it's only important if you have a surround sound setup or a dedicated soundbar. You can still get the same audio-video experience without passthrough, but you'll have more wires going to and from your TV.

When should I use HDMI passthrough?

This is handier when you need the signal from your source devices, such as a set-top box or Blu-ray player, to pass through an intermediary device such as an audio receiver or a home theatre system, and exit unaltered. An intermediary device that features HDMI pass-through must have at least two HDMI ports.

Why can't I hear the game through my turtle beaches?

If the Power/Pairing and Digital Input LEDs on the transmitter are lit up and solid, but you still cannot hear any game audio, the sound settings on your console may not be configured correctly. PS3: Go to Settings > Audio Output Settings > Optical Digital and check 'Dolby Digital 5.1 Ch'.
